Using link bait.
Don’t underestimate the power of link bait. What is link bait? is a web site content that features high levels of traffic, numerous links and visibility/branding.
You can create link bait in many ways: By promoting a weekend link bait on popular social websites like Digg, Reddit, de.icio.us or Stumbleupon. This is by the far the easiest and most powerful way to get traffic to your site during the weekends, or using element that encourage linking as email or call relevant friends.
